安卓应用闪屏

安卓应用闪屏

💡 原文中文,约3000字,阅读约需8分钟。
📝

内容提要

本文介绍了在安卓SDK中实现手写闪屏的方法。通过创建闪屏Activity并设置动画,用户在游戏启动时可以看到闪屏。文中提供了代码示例和注意事项,包括控制动画时间和结束闪屏Activity,以避免应用重启时闪屏重复出现的问题。

🎯

关键要点

  • 在接入安卓SDK时,有些渠道要求手写闪屏。
  • 创建一个闪屏Activity,以便在游戏启动时显示闪屏。
  • 需要在Manifest中注册闪屏Activity,以避免打包时出现错误。
  • 闪屏Activity的代码示例中使用了ObjectAnimator来控制动画效果。
  • 闪屏的背景色和图片需要在style.xml中进行设置。
  • 动画播放完成后,启动主Activity并结束闪屏Activity,以避免应用重启时闪屏重复出现。

延伸问答

如何在安卓应用中实现手写闪屏?

可以通过创建一个闪屏Activity并设置动画来实现手写闪屏,用户在游戏启动时会看到闪屏。

闪屏Activity需要在Manifest中做什么?

闪屏Activity需要在Manifest中注册,以避免打包时出现错误。

如何控制闪屏动画的时间?

可以通过设置ObjectAnimator的持续时间来控制闪屏动画的时间。

闪屏结束后应该如何处理?

闪屏结束后应启动主Activity并结束闪屏Activity,以避免应用重启时闪屏重复出现。

闪屏的背景色和图片如何设置?

闪屏的背景色和图片需要在style.xml中进行设置。

使用ObjectAnimator时需要注意什么?

使用ObjectAnimator时需要注意动画的进度和结束时间的判定,以确保动画正常播放。

➡️

继续阅读